Beyond The Gross Factor: Things Every Homeowner Should Know About Cockroach Infestations

Cockroaches are one of the most reviled pests that can invade your home, and it is understandable that the thought of dealing with an infestation is enough to leave you feeling squeamish. However, it is important to be informed as a homeowner about the importance of handling cockroach infestations the right way....

